Background:
- Yoshiki Sasai was a pioneering researcher in developmental biology.
- His work focused on understanding the principles of tissue formation and self-organization.
- Sasai's research significantly advanced the field of stem cell biology.

Key Insights:
- Sasai's research elucidated fundamental mechanisms of organ development from stem cells.
- He pioneered the development of 3D organ culture techniques, known as organoids.
- His work laid the foundation for regenerative medicine and disease modeling.
